1985–86 Eastern Counties Football League
The 1985–86 Eastern Counties Football League season was the 44th in the history of Eastern Counties Football League a football competition in England.[1]
Clubs
Season | 1985–86 |
---|---|
Champions | Sudbury Town |
Matches played | 462 |
Goals scored | 1,534 (3.32 per match) |
← 1984–85 1986–87 → |
The league featured 22 clubs which competed in the league last season, no new clubs joined the league this season.
League table
Pos | Team | Pld | W | D | L | GF | GA | GD | Pts |
---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
1 | Sudbury Town | 42 | 30 | 6 | 6 | 107 | 45 | +62 | 66 |
2 | Colchester United reserves | 42 | 29 | 6 | 7 | 109 | 49 | +60 | 64 |
3 | Great Yarmouth Town | 42 | 29 | 5 | 8 | 95 | 46 | +49 | 63 |
4 | Bury Town | 42 | 23 | 10 | 9 | 93 | 54 | +39 | 56 |
5 | Tiptree United | 42 | 24 | 7 | 11 | 78 | 54 | +24 | 55 |
6 | Braintree Town | 42 | 22 | 11 | 9 | 91 | 53 | +38 | 55 |
7 | March Town United | 42 | 22 | 8 | 12 | 74 | 62 | +12 | 52 |
8 | Stowmarket Town | 42 | 19 | 13 | 10 | 79 | 62 | +17 | 51 |
9 | Wisbech Town | 42 | 22 | 5 | 15 | 79 | 55 | +24 | 49 |
10 | Histon | 42 | 20 | 7 | 15 | 75 | 58 | +17 | 47 |
11 | Lowestoft Town | 42 | 16 | 12 | 14 | 75 | 50 | +25 | 44 |
12 | Felixstowe Town | 42 | 19 | 6 | 17 | 62 | 54 | +8 | 44 |
13 | Gorleston | 42 | 15 | 9 | 18 | 74 | 64 | +10 | 39 |
14 | Haverhill Rovers | 42 | 16 | 6 | 20 | 61 | 59 | +2 | 38 |
15 | Thetford Town | 42 | 10 | 10 | 22 | 48 | 87 | −39 | 30 |
16 | Brantham Athletic | 42 | 13 | 4 | 25 | 57 | 108 | −51 | 30 |
17 | Harwich & Parkeston | 42 | 10 | 9 | 23 | 52 | 72 | −20 | 29 |
18 | Soham Town Rangers | 42 | 11 | 7 | 24 | 55 | 92 | −37 | 29 |
19 | Chatteris Town | 42 | 10 | 6 | 26 | 37 | 79 | −42 | 26 |
20 | Ely City | 42 | 8 | 9 | 25 | 46 | 82 | −36 | 25 |
21 | Newmarket Town | 42 | 9 | 5 | 28 | 59 | 119 | −60 | 23 |
22 | Clacton Town | 42 | 2 | 5 | 35 | 28 | 130 | −102 | 9 |
Source: fchd
Rules for classification: 1) points; 2) goal difference; 3) number of goals scored.
